Description: KDE application to configure TCP/IP settings
KNetworkConf is a KDE application which works as a frontend
to the GNOME System Tools (GST) to configure TCP/IP settings.
.
KNetworkConf features configuration of:
.
* Network devices
* Default gateway
* Host and domain names
* DNS servers
* Local host name lookup (/etc/hosts)
.
Once installed the functionality of KNetworkConf can be
reached through the KDE Control Center under Network Settings.
